TOP 3 NEWS

■ Exports in early April reach record high of $25.2 billion, driven by semiconductors
○ Korea Customs Service: Preliminary export and import totals for April 1-10
○ Exports surge by 36.7%, trade surplus at $3.1 billion
○ Semiconductor share expands to 34%
■ Trump admits "High oil prices could last until the November midterm elections"
○ Inflation puts pressure on cost of living in the U.S.
○ Political standing of Trump and the Republican Party weakens
○ Democratic Party attacks: "Oil prices at record levels for years"
■ Army special forces to fully replace rifles for the first time in 40 years
○ K1A submachine guns in special forces to be completely replaced
○ SNT Motiv selected as final contractor
○ 65.4 billion won invested to introduce 16,000 new rifles
